Step-by-step explanation:
Heat is a type of property that depends on the amount of matter present. Therefore, it is classified as an extensive property, and since it pertains to energy transferred rather than matter transformed, it is a physical property, not a chemical one. We can see this by considering scenarios such as heating up different amounts of a substance; the total amount of heat energy will vary depending on the mass, even though the temperature might be the same. This defines heat as an extensive physical property.
